      I´m at 552 plugins so far :) There´s still a ways to go until it can be considered somewhat stable. Advanced Needs is an interesting one, but I´ve gotten used to vanilla survival with some modifications, and I worry about the added scriptload and a modlist this big. We´ll see..I used to do merges but stopped as soon as flagging esps as esl became possble. I just got weary of having to redo merges everytime I changed something. To each their own, this works for me. I reckon a lot of the plugins in the fixes section could be merged, I might revisit merges in the future. We´ll see.

      1) Manual, then extract all of them to the patched files folder in your workbase. Launch archive2 in your workbase, open the .ba2-files then extract them one by one (Archive/Extract) to your patchedfiles folder (If it won't extract, what I did was make a new folder, extract them there then after I was done extracting, I took the textures folder out and removed everything)

      2) You only need the textures folder in your patchedfiles (page 27, it should look something like that)
